The quadratic equation shown in the graph is y = 3*(x + 3)² - 8

Howto write the quadratic equation?

A quadratic equation with a vertex (h, k) and a leading coefficient a, can be written as:

y = a*(x - h)² + k

Here the vertex is (-3, -8), then we can write:

y = a*(x + 3)² - 8

Now, notice that the graph also contains the point (-4, -5), replacing these values we will get:

-5 = a*(-4 + 3)² - 8

-5 = a - 8

-5 + 8 = a

3 = a

The equation is:

y = 3*(x + 3)² - 8
